Chris Sale pounds on ice chest after frustrating outing (GIF)

Chicago White Sox starting pitcher Chris Sale pounded on an ice chest in the dugout to release some frustration after a disappointing outing against the Texas Rangers Friday night.

Sale gave up eight runs on seven innings. After being notified that he was done for the day, Sale began to slam an ice chest with his glove, then with both hands, before finally knocking it over and spilling the contents onto the floor.
